KEYNOTE: Geopolitical risk and its implications for Asia

Steve Wilford, Partner, Asia Pacific of Global Risk Analysis at Control Risks


Geopolitics is driving up anxiety in boardrooms. Companies are expecting continuing risk of escalation and overspill from the Ukraine-Russia conflict and US-China rivalry, increased weaponisation of cyberspace, and intensifying clash of national interests – all of which have significant implications on business in Asia. Your clients will be monitoring for signs of decoupling in critical areas of their supply chains. Greater trade and investment restrictions, export sanctions, data protection laws, and other economic regulations will complicate strategic and tactical business decisions. These will create challenges, and potential opportunities, for businesses and for you as their legal counsel.
